Cochin Port Trust and Indian Navy have signed an agreement reserving the Q2-Q3 berths at Mattacherry wharf of Cochin Port for naval ships. The Q2 and Q3 berths, totalling 228 metres of quay length, is being handed over to Indian Navy for five years. Indian Navy had requested for exclusive berthing facility in the port to undertake reconstruction work on their berths, a press release said. It was decided that Mattacherry wharf, which is the oldest wharf, could be spared since they are not suitable for berthing big cargo ships because of draft limitation and displacement, the release added.
